10 Steps to Writing Clean Code

10 Steps to Writing Clean Code

Clean code means a scalable organization. It means being able to pivot plans without much chaos. As systems scale and grow, it is inevitable that old technology practices and hacks get left behind in the code. Here's how to make sure this doesn't happen.

Best Firefox plugins for devs

Best Firefox plugins for devs

We spend more time on the browser than we do anywhere else. Whether we're designing, building, or going deep into the research rabbit-hole, the browser is the breeding ground for most of our ideas and tools. That's why collecting a good repertoir of plugins is so crucial to optimizing our workflow.

The power of learning to code

The power of learning to code

If someone told me 6 months ago that today I’d be helping people learn to code around the globe at the world’s top-rated coding bootcamp, I would call bullshit.